About Coffee Beans & Products from Transcend

At Transcend we focus on delivering unparalleled coffee experiences. We scour the globe for the highest quality organic coffee beans and carefully brew them to bring out all their exotic flavours. Our coffee beans are grown in the rich soils of countries such as Guatemala, Panama, Kenya, Colombia, Costa Rica, Ethiopia and many others. Relationship coffee is an important part of what we do. It simply means we strive to build strong relationships with our coffee growers by paying them substantially more than Fair Trade prices. Transcend also strives to purchase coffee beans from farms that employ environmentally conscious policies, like those that are encouraged by the Rainforest Alliance.

Our organic espresso blend is one of our most popular items, consisting of an ever-evolving blend of high quality coffees balanced and tested to taste great as espresso and blend beautifully with milk for lattes and cappuccinos.
